Lord Mandelson Accuses Police of Baseless Arrest Over Alleged Flight Plans
Former Labour minister Lord Mandelson has publicly accused police of arresting him based on what he describes as "baseless" claims that he planned to flee abroad. The incident, which has ignited a significant controversy, involves allegations that law enforcement acted on unsubstantiated information, raising questions about police procedures and accountability in high-profile cases.
Details of the Arrest and Allegations
According to reports, Lord Mandelson was detained by police officers who allegedly acted on intelligence suggesting he intended to leave the country. Mandelson has vehemently denied these claims, stating that there was no factual basis for the arrest and that it was a result of misinformation or possibly malicious intent. He emphasized that he had no plans to flee and that the arrest was an unwarranted intrusion into his personal and professional life.
The arrest has drawn attention to the methods used by police in handling sensitive information, with critics arguing that such actions could undermine public trust in law enforcement. Mandelson, a prominent figure in UK politics, has called for a thorough investigation into the matter to ensure that similar incidents do not occur in the future.
